Charles Schwab Investment Management Inc. grew its holdings in shares of Amerant Bancorp Inc. (NASDAQ:AMTB - Free Report) by 11.2% during the fourth quarter, according to the company in its most recent filing with the Securities and Exchange Commission. The institutional investor owned 301,142 shares of the company's stock after buying an additional 30,219 shares during the period. Charles Schwab Investment Management Inc. owned 0.72% of Amerant Bancorp worth $6,749,000 as of its most recent SEC filing.

Other hedge funds and other institutional investors have also recently modified their holdings of the company. Barclays PLC increased its position in Amerant Bancorp by 121.2% during the 3rd quarter. Barclays PLC now owns 67,916 shares of the company's stock valued at $1,452,000 after buying an additional 37,208 shares in the last quarter. Geode Capital Management LLC increased its holdings in shares of Amerant Bancorp by 13.6% during the third quarter. Geode Capital Management LLC now owns 734,376 shares of the company's stock valued at $15,697,000 after acquiring an additional 87,696 shares in the last quarter. Allspring Global Investments Holdings LLC raised its position in shares of Amerant Bancorp by 47.5% in the 4th quarter. Allspring Global Investments Holdings LLC now owns 479,466 shares of the company's stock worth $10,745,000 after purchasing an additional 154,466 shares during the last quarter. JPMorgan Chase & Co. boosted its stake in Amerant Bancorp by 7.9% in the 3rd quarter. JPMorgan Chase & Co. now owns 23,261 shares of the company's stock worth $497,000 after purchasing an additional 1,705 shares in the last quarter. Finally, Angel Oak Capital Advisors LLC bought a new position in Amerant Bancorp in the 4th quarter worth about $336,000. 42.11% of the stock is owned by hedge funds and other institutional investors.

Amerant Bancorp Stock Performance

AMTB traded down $0.65 during midday trading on Friday, hitting $20.62. 278,511 shares of the company traded hands, compared to its average volume of 172,679. The company's 50-day moving average is $22.44 and its 200 day moving average is $22.38. The company has a quick ratio of 0.94, a current ratio of 1.01 and a debt-to-equity ratio of 1.18. The firm has a market capitalization of $864.56 million, a PE ratio of -36.18 and a beta of 1.06. Amerant Bancorp Inc. has a 52 week low of $18.54 and a 52 week high of $27.00.

Amerant Bancorp Announces Dividend

The business also recently disclosed a quarterly dividend, which was paid on Friday, February 28th. Investors of record on Friday, February 14th were given a dividend of $0.09 per share. The ex-dividend date of this dividend was Friday, February 14th. This represents a $0.36 dividend on an annualized basis and a yield of 1.75%. Amerant Bancorp's dividend payout ratio (DPR) is -63.16%.

Wall Street Analysts Forecast Growth

Several brokerages have issued reports on AMTB. Keefe, Bruyette & Woods lifted their target price on shares of Amerant Bancorp from $25.00 to $27.00 and gave the stock a "market perform" rating in a report on Monday, January 27th. Stephens restated an "overweight" rating and issued a $29.00 price objective on shares of Amerant Bancorp in a report on Thursday, January 23rd. Two research analysts have rated the stock with a hold rating and three have assigned a buy rating to the stock. Based on data from MarketBeat, the company has an average rating of "Moderate Buy" and a consensus price target of $27.00.

About Amerant Bancorp

(Free Report)

Amerant Bancorp Inc operates as the bank holding company for Amerant Bank, N.A. that provides banking products and services to individuals and businesses in the United States and internationally. It offers checking, savings, business, and money market accounts; cash management services; and certificates of deposits.
